II. If you’ve been genuinely mistreated, do you have the right to be offended?
Genesis 37-48
 Joseph had very limited freedom in his life
He still had the right to choose his response to all that had happened to him.
II. Is God in Control ?
1. When something offends us wee can respond in two ways:
1. Blame Others
2. Recognize that God is in Control.
2. Absolutely no man, woman, child, or devil can ever get you out of the will of God!
3. No-one but God holds your destiny.


III. God always has a plan
“But now, do not therefore be grieved or angry with yourselves because you sold me here; for God sent me before you to preserve life. For these two years the famine has been in the land, and there are still five years in which there will be neither plowing nor harvesting. And God sent me before you to preserve posterity for you in the earth, and to save your lives by a great deliverance. So now it was not you who sent me here, but God…” (Gen 45:5-8).
Who sent Joseph? His brothers or God?
No mortal man or devil can supersede the plan of God for your life.
We must remember that nothing can come against us without the Lord’s knowledge of it before it ever happens.
“No temptation has overtaken you except such as is common to man; but God is faithful, who will not allow you to be tempted beyond what you’re able, but with the temptation will also make the way of escape, that you may be able to bear it” (I Corinthians 10:13).
